Market Notes
Compared to last week: Feeder steers sold 3.00 to 7.00 higher. Feeder heifers sold 3.00 to 7.00 higher. Slaughter cows sold steady. Slaughter bulls sold steady.
Supply included: 77% Feeder Cattle (33% Steers, 46% Heifers, 21% Bulls); 13% Slaughter Cattle (74% Cows, 26% Bulls); 10% Replacement Cattle (71% Bred Cows, 21% Bred Heifers, 7% Cow-Calf Pairs). Feeder cattle supply over 600 lbs was 14%.
LIVESTOCK SUMMARY This Week Last Reported 1/13/2021 Last Year Total Receipts: 901 814 1,089 Feeder Cattle: 695(77.1%) 625(76.8%) 921(84.6%) Slaughter Cattle: 118(13.1%) 68(8.4%) 121(11.1%) Replacement Cattle: 88(9.8%) 121(14.9%) 47(4.3%)
